#cd7a88 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cd7a88 is composed of 80.4% red, 47.8%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.5% magenta, 33.7%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 349.9 degrees, a saturation of 45.4% and a lightness of 64.1%. #cd7a88 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ff4ff with #9b0011.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#cd7a88 color description : Slightly desaturated red.

#cd7a88 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cd7a88 has RGB values of R:205, G:122,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.4, Y:0.34,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13466248.

Shades and Tints of #cd7a88

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0405 is the darkest color, while #fdfafb is the lightest one.

Tones of #cd7a88

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aa9d9f is the less saturated color, while #fe4967 is the most saturated one.
